首页 综合百科文章正文

java如何访问数据库中的数据类型

综合百科 2025年11月21日 08:39 261 admin

Java中如何访问数据库中的数据类型

在Java开发中,访问数据库是常见的需求,无论是进行数据查询、更新还是删除操作,了解如何在Java中处理不同类型的数据库数据都是非常重要的,本文将详细介绍如何在Java中访问和处理来自数据库的各种数据类型。

java如何访问数据库中的数据类型

我们需要使用JDBC(Java Database Connectivity)API来连接和操作数据库,JDBC是Java提供的标准API,用于执行SQL语句并处理结果,要使用JDBC,你需要添加JDBC驱动程序到你的项目中,并确保你的数据库服务器正在运行。

我们将展示如何通过JDBC获取和处理不同类型的数据库数据,假设我们有一个名为“users”的表,其中包含以下字段:id(INT),name(VARCHAR),age(INT)。

java如何访问数据库中的数据类型

  1. 连接到数据库:
    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/yourdatabase", "username", "password");

  2. 创建Statement对象:
    Statement stmt = conn.createStatement();

  3. 执行查询:
    ResultSet rs = stmt.executeQuery("SELECT * FROM users");

  4. 处理结果集:
    while (rs.next()) {
     int id = rs.getInt("id"); // 获取INT类型的数据
     String name = rs.getString("name"); // 获取VARCHAR类型的数据
     int age = rs.getInt("age"); // 获取INT类型的数据
     System.out.println("ID: " + id + ", Name: " + name + ", Age: " + age);
    }

  5. 关闭连接:
    rs.close();
    stmt.close();
    conn.close();

    代码展示了如何从数据库中获取不同类型的数据并将其存储在相应的Java数据类型中,需要注意的是,不同的数据库可能有不同的JDBC驱动程序,因此需要根据你使用的数据库选择合适的驱动程序。

标签: Java数据库连接

丫丫技术百科 备案号:新ICP备2024010732号-62 网站地图